Def need Jackson back. I saw several balls today thrown Cocrell's way today that I'm for sure Jackson would've picked. 

Cockrell has been ok, but def seems to be getting picked on these last 2 games.

This probably has as much to do with him not being Bradberry as anything. The other corner across from a shutdown tends to get picked on. You notice that as well as Minshew played, the few times he tried to throw on Bradberry it didn’t go well for him.

Jackson does some things well and Cockrell does other things well. Honestly I think they should rotate those guys based on their opponent and situation. Cockrell seems to be less likely to be caught out of position and plays a bit more disciplined than Jackson, but obviously Jackson has some rare speed and physical ability that Cockrell doesn't have.
